- Certain embodiments according to the invention provide a nonwoven fabric comprising first nonwoven layer comprising a first meltblown layer.
- the first meltblown layer may comprise a first polymeric material including (i) a first polymer component and (ii) optionally one or more first additives.
- the first polymer component may comprise a first recycled-polypropylene (rPP).

- continuous fibers refers to fibers which are not cut from their original length prior to being formed into a nonwoven web or nonwoven fabric. Continuous fibers may have average lengths ranging from greater than about 15 centimeters to more than one meter, and up to the length of the web or fabric being formed.
- a continuous fiber as used herein, may comprise a fiber in which the length of the fiber is at least 1,000 times larger than the average diameter of the fiber, such as the length of the fiber being at least about 5,000, 10,000, 50,000, or 100,000 times larger than the average diameter of the fiber.

- the first polymer component may comprise from 75% to 100% by weight of the first rPP, such as at least about any of the following: 75, 78, 80, 82, 85, 88, and 90% by weight of the first rPP, and/or at most about any of the following: 100, 99, 98, 96, 95, 94, 92, and 90% by weight of the first rPP.
- the rPP may be blended with virgin polypropylene, virgin elastomeric polymers, etc. (e.g., the balance of the first polymer component may be virgin polypropylene and/or virgin elastomeric polymers).
- the hard blocks may comprise 10-90% by weight of the copolymer while the soft blocks may comprise from 90-10% by weight of the copolymer.
- these copolymers include a random ethylene distribution throughout the copolymer.
- VistamaxxTM e.g., VistamaxxTM 6202 copolymers are commercially available from ExxonMobil. VistamaxxTM 6202 has a density of 0.862 g/cc, a MI (190°C/2.16 kg) of 9.1, a MFR (230°C/2.16 kg load) of 20, and an ethylene content of 15% by weight.
- An additional example includes an olefin diblock copolymer comprising an EP-iPP diblock polymer such as IntuneTM, which is a polypropylene-based block copolymer including ethylene monomers.
- the polypropylene-based elastomer may comprise an EP-iPP diblock polymer that has an ethylene content from 43 to 48% by weight, or from 43.5 to 47% by weight, or from 44 to 47% by weight, based on the weight of the diblock copolymer.
- the rPP melt and the resulting meltblown layer comprising rPP is devoid of an elastomeric polymer.
- the rPP and the resulting meltblown layer comprising rPP may be formed entirely from polypropylene (e.g., rPP, virgin polypropylene, or blends thereof).
- the plurality of first meltblown fibers may comprise meltblown shot, meltblown ropes, or both.
- the meltblown shot, the meltblown rope, or both may be randomly and irregularly distributed throughout the meltblown layer, on a first outer surface of the meltblown layer, or both. If present, the meltblown shot, meltblown ropes, or both impart an increased abrasive feature and/or surface to the nonwoven fabric.
- the first meltblown layer may comprise an average shot height, rope height, or both from about 0.1 mm to about 1.0 mm, such as at least about any of the following: 0.1, 0.2, 0.3, 0.4, and 0.5 mm, and/or at most about any of the following: 1, 0.9, 0.8, 0.7, 0.6, and 0.5 mm.
- the meltblown shot may comprise irregularly shaped fibers, wads, or particles.
- the meltblown rope may comprise bundles of agglomerated meltblown fibers having a variable crosssection along a length of the meltblown rope.
